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: What cybersecurity threats specifically target healthcare IoT devices?
A: Ransomware attacks disrupting hospital operations. Patient data breaches accessing sensitive information. Device hijacking redirecting therapy or care decisions. Network intrusion using devices as entry points. DDoS attacks using compromised devices. These threats justify comprehensive security emphasis.

Q2: How are healthcare organizations implementing IoT security?
A: Network segmentation isolating medical device networks. Device authentication preventing unauthorized access. Encryption protecting data in transit. Vulnerability management identifying and patching weaknesses. Continuous monitoring detecting suspicious activity. These measures collectively secure IoT environments.
